Vocabulary expansion for children aged 5-8 is crucial for their cognitive and communicative development. At this formative stage, kids are eager to learn and absorb new words, which shapes their understanding of the world. A rich vocabulary enhances their ability to express thoughts, feelings, and ideas clearly, fostering confidence in communication. Moreover, vocabulary acquisition is closely linked to reading comprehension; the larger their vocabulary, the better they can understand what they read, paving the way for academic success.
Parents and teachers play a key role in this process. By introducing age-appropriate, context-rich words during everyday interactions, storytelling, and educational activities, they can create an engaging and encouraging learning environment. Activities that combine fun with learning, such as word games or rhyming challenges, can stimulate interest and make vocabulary acquisition enjoyable.
Strong vocabulary skills not only benefit academic outcomes but also enhance social competencies, as children learn to articulate their feelings, understand others, and engage in conversations. Investing in vocabulary expansion at this crucial age will provide children with the necessary tools to navigate the complexities of language and communication throughout their lives, ultimately supporting their overall development and future opportunities.
